Description

The ZoxPress - The All-In-One WordPress News Theme theme for WordPress is vulnerable to unauthorized modification of data that can lead to privilege escalation due to a missing capability check on the 'backup_options' and 'restore_options' functions in all versions up to, and including, 2.12.0.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to update arbitrary options on the WordPress site. This can be leveraged to update the default role for registration to administrator and enable user registration for attackers to gain administrative user access to a vulnerable site.

Security Summary

CVE-2024-13653 is a privilege escalation vulnerability in the ZoxPress - The All-In-One WordPress News Theme for WordPress, affecting all versions up to and including 2.12.0. The issue stems from a missing capability check on the 'backup_options' and 'restore_options' functions, enabling unauthorized modification of data. This flaw, classified under CWE-862 (Missing Authorization), carries a CVSS v3.1 base score of 8.8 (A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H), indicating high severity due to its potential for significant imp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

Authenticated attackers with Subscriber-level access or higher can exploit this vulnerability remotely over the network with low complexity and no user interaction required. By calling the affected functions, they can update arbitrary WordPress options, such as changing the default user role for new registrations to administrator and enabling user registration. This allows attackers to create accounts with full administrative privileges on the vulnerable site.
